Biography

This profile is part of the Baucom Name Study.

Calvin Ransom Baucom was born on August 29, 1885 in Union County, North Carolina.[1] His parents were Alvis Baucom and Ella (Smith) Baucom.[2][1]

He married Sarah "Sallie" Scott on January 18, 1906 in Union County, North Carolina.[3] The couple had seven children between 1910 and 1930:[4][5]

  1. Florence Lillian (Baucom) McAulay[6]
  2. Bryce[sic] Baucom[4][5][7]
  3. Vance Baucom[4]
  4. Alice Hazeltime "Hazel" Baucom[8]
  5. Alma Lucille Baucom[9]
  6. Margaret Doris Baucom[10]
  7. Cyrus Howard Baucom[11][12]

He died on January 08, 1958 in Rockingham, Richmond County, North Carolina.[1] He and Sarah are buried in Richmond County Memorial Park, Rockingham, Richmond County North Carolina.[13] His obituary was published in The News and Observer on 9 January 1958 in Raleigh, North Carolina.[14]
